What exactly is a Registered Agent?
A registered agent is an person or business entity appointed by a company or limited liability company to accept legal paperwork and government correspondence on behalf of the company. This role is essential for ensuring adherence with state laws, as every registered business must designate a registered agent to ensure there is a consistent point of contact for legal issues. The registered agent is responsible for accepting legal notices, tax notices, and other official communications, which must be forwarded to the relevant individuals within the company.
In most states, a registered agent must have a real address in the state where the business is incorporated, known as the office of record. This condition ensures that there is a reliable location where official papers can be sent. The registered agent can be an individual, such as a business official or proprietor, or a third-party service that focuses in offering registered agent services. Selecting a qualified registered agent can allow businesses to maintain privacy and ensure that critical papers are handled promptly.
Registered agents play a key role in ensuring compliance, as they must keep track of regulatory obligations and deadlines. Failure to react to legal communications or keep a registered agent can lead to fines, sanctions, or even the deterioration of the business's reputation. Thus, selecting the appropriate agent service is essential for all corporations and LLCs, enabling them to focus on their main activities while ensuring all legal requirements are fulfilled.

Designated Representative Duties and Compliance
The key responsibility of a designated agent is to receive and handle legal documents on behalf of a business. This includes crucial notifications such as service of process, financial documents, and regulatory documents. By appointing a designated agent, companies ensure they have a reliable point of contact for law-related matters, thus helping to preserve their positive status and prevent penalties. A organization registered agent must be accessible during standard business hours to accept these documents.
In addition to receiving legal documents, appointed agents are responsible for upholding compliance with jurisdictional regulations. This includes ensuring that the company is filed with the appropriate government agencies and that its documentation is up to date. Failure to comply with these legal requirements can lead in grave consequences, including fines or termination of the entity. Understanding the legal obligations helps company owners stay vigilant in their compliance efforts.
Another important aspect of a registered agent's role is to offer confidentiality for business owners. By using a professional appointed agent service, the company owner's private address is maintained off public records, reducing the risk of unwelcome solicitations or personal invasions. This is particularly crucial for Limited Liability Company registered agents and corporate registered agents who may not want their home addresses associated with formal business operations.
